ASocks vs Bart Proxies FAQ

Is ASocks cheaper than Bart Proxies?

Bart Proxies has the lower entry price at $2 per IP, compared with $3 per GB for ASocks. Always size the cost to your real monthly usage, since per-GB and per-IP plans scale differently.

Which has more locations, ASocks or Bart Proxies?

Bart Proxies advertises the wider footprint with 197 countries versus 150 for ASocks.

Which has a bigger proxy network, ASocks or Bart Proxies?

ASocks lists the larger IP pool at 7M+, while Bart Proxies lists 500K+. A larger pool usually means more unique IPs and lower block rates at scale.
